Judge nixes Justice Department subpoena of telehealth trans health care provider
https://www.advocate.com/news/judge-nixes-doj-subpoena-queerdoc
🔗
Trudy Ring (30 Oct 2025)
A federal judge has quashed the Department of Justice's subpoena for the records of QueerDoc, a telehealth service that prescribes medications and offers consulting for gender-affirming care in 10 states.
The DOJ subpoenaed QueerDoc June 11, requesting personnel information, documents identifying patients, patients' medical records, billing records, insurance claims, communications with drugmakers, and more. It was among more than 20 such subpoenas issued.
The same day, the DOJ's Civil Division issued a memo saying it would "prioritize investigations of doctors, hospitals, pharmaceutical companies, and other appropriate entities" for "possible violations of the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act and other laws" regarding medications used in gender-affirming care and False Claims Act violations by health care providers who "evade state bans on gender dysphoria treatments by knowingly submitting claims to Medicaid with false diagnosis codes."
In April, Attorney General Pam Bondi released a memo saying the DOJ would "act decisively to protect our children and hold accountable those who mutilate them under the guise of care." She used the same language about mutilation in a later press release. That a day after QueerDoc filed motions with a U.S. District Court in Washington State to quash the subpoena and seal the court proceedings, according to the court.
"DOJ issued its inflammatory press release declaring that medical professionals have 'mutilated children in the service of a warped ideology,' one day after QueerDoc filed these motions, effectively destroying any claim to investigative confidentiality while attempting to sway public sentiment against healthcare providers like QueerDoc," Judge Jamal Whitehead wrote in his ruling, which came out Monday. "Such conduct appears calculated to intimidate rather than investigate."
